Step Back in Time: Guided Walks Through the Hallowed Grounds of the Old Course
Overview
Guided Walks of the Old Course offers an unparalleled opportunity to explore the historic links. St Andrews Links Clubhouse, a focal point of golfing history, provides a fitting starting point for this immersive experience. The Old Course, famed for hosting The Open Championship numerous times, has witnessed legendary golfers like Jack Nicklaus, Tiger Woods, and Bobby Jones achieve iconic victories. Nestled in St Andrews, a Scottish town steeped in history and academic tradition, the Old Course has earned its reputation as the 'Home of Golf'. Expect engaging narratives about the course's evolution, legendary matches, and the indelible mark it has left on the world of golf. User reviews often praise the knowledgeable guides and the intimate connection to golfing history.
